Output 1588dcdc8f9be599f2fbf8c8a6bce993ffa61808ee34d765e1b31350e246c585:6

value
26650700
script pubkey
OP_0 OP_PUSHBYTES_20 bacbd3d942bb8b29f8a4cedfc8ff17a75b11032f
address
bc1qht9a8k2zhw9jn79yem0u3lch5ad3zqe095cm29
transaction
1588dcdc8f9be599f2fbf8c8a6bce993ffa61808ee34d765e1b31350e246c585
confirmations
107340
spent
true